Public employees to receive 2,000-shekel advance on January salaries tomorrow amid financial crisis

“RAMALLAH, 19 April 2026 (WAFA) -The Ministry of Finance and Planning announced on Sunday that public employees’ salaries for January 2026 will be partially disbursed tomorrow, Monday, at a fixed amount of 2,000 shekels (approximately $335) for all civil and military public sector employees across all grades and ranks, due to the continued Israeli withholding of clearance revenues”
